Official abstract text for this publication.
An apparatus and method to facilitate providing recommendations are disclosed herein. A networked system receives a query image, and performs image processing to extract a color histogram of an item depicted in the query image. The networked system identifies a dominant color of the item, whereby the dominant color is a color that is present on a most spatial area of the item relative to any other color of the item. The color histogram of the item is compared with a color histogram of an image of each of a plurality of available items, or the dominate color of the item is compared with a dominate color of the image of each of a plurality of available items. Based on the comparing, the networked system identifies item recommendations of the available items that closely match the item depicted in the query image, and the item recommendations are presented.

What is claimed is: 1. A method comprising: receiving, at a networked system from an application installed on a device of a user, a query image captured by the device via the application; performing, by the networked system, image processing to extract a color histogram of an item depicted in the query image; identifying, by a hardware processor of the networked system, a dominant color of the item depicted in the query image, the dominant color being a color that is present on a most spatial area of the item relative to any other color of the item; comparing, by the networked system, the color histogram of the item depicted in the query image with a color histogram of an image of each of a plurality of available items or the dominate color of the item depicted in the query image with a dominate color of the image of each of a plurality of available items; based on the comparing, identifying, by the networked system, item recommendations of the available items that closely match the item depicted in the query image; and causing presentation of the item recommendations on the device of the user. 2. The method of claim 1 , further comprising determining a dominate color confidence score using the color histogram of the query image. 3. The method of claim 2 , wherein the comparing comprises: comparing, by the networked system, the color histogram of the item depicted in the query image with the color histogram of the image of each of the plurality of available items based on the dominate color confidence score being low, or comparing, by the networked system, the dominate color of the item depicted in the query image with a dominate color of the image of each of a plurality of available items based on the dominate color confidence score being high. 4. The method of claim 1 , wherein the identifying the dominant color comprises re-using hue values from the color histogram and identifying a bin within a bin group corresponding to the hue values that has a highest peak. 5. The method of claim 1 , further comprising providing the application for installation on the device of the user, the application including camera capabilities that configure the device to capture the query image, the application transmitting the query image to the networked system. 6. The method of claim 1 , further comprising: receiving, by the networked system from the remote device, a selection of a recommendation from the item recommendations; and in response to receiving the selection of the recommendation, causing display of item details and an image of the selected recommendation on the user interface of the remote device. 7. The method of claim 6 , further comprising, in response to receiving the selection of the recommendation, determining a set of refined recommendations; and causing display of the set of refined recommendations on the user interface displaying the item details and the image of the selected recommendation. 8.
